BLACKPINK Jisoo & Jung Hae In’s Upcoming Drama ‘Snowdrop’ Pauses Filming for the Safety of All

According to the report, the filming of JTBC's forthcoming drama "Snowdrop," starring BLACKPINK's Jisoo and Jung Hae In, has been paused since Nov. 23 when a supporting actor potentially had close contact with a COVID-19 positive while filming on the set of another drama.  

The supporting actor informed immediately the production team of "Snowdrop" about his said encounter. He underwent testing, and now waiting for the results. He is also said to be in a self-quarantine.

An official statement from JTBC was released amidst of the said happening.

"We have confirmed that there are no confirmed cases of Coronavirus within the Snowdrop team, but there is an extra actor who was in close contact with a confirmed case.

We have temporarily suspended filming to prevent the spread of the Coronavirus and for the safety of all our team. We are waiting for the results of the test."

The staff and production members who had a close contact with the supporting actor voluntarily proceed for a COVID-19 testing, for the safety of each and everyone in the set.

The filming date will resume until further noticed.

"Snowdrop" is a much-awaited drama and is gaining a lot of attention for this will be the first acting project of one of the members of the well-known K-pop girl group BLAKCPINK, Kim Jisoo. The singer, through the drama, will show the other side of her as an artist.

"Snowdrop" is a drama that is set in 1987 when a dictatorial government-led South Korea.  

The story will start when a male university student named Im Soo Ho (played by Jung Hae In) ends up in a women's dormitory at Hosoo Women's University, where he met Eun Young Cho (Kim Jisoo). The male student is covered in blood and is seeking help. He is nowhere to go, not until Eun Young Cho finds him and humbly helped him. After their encounter, they develop romantic feelings for each other.

Im Soo Hoo is a charismatic yet mysterious Korean-German who graduated from a prestigious university.  

Meanwhile, BLACKPINK Jisoo's character Eun Yong Cho is a first-year college student at Hosoo Women's University, pursuing a major in English literature.Joining them is Kim Hye Yoon, who is known for her role in the drama "Extraordinary You." She will be playing as Kye Boon Ok, who gave up her dream of entering university due to financial problems. She works as a telephone operator at a women's dormitory. 

Meanwhile, Jang Seung Jo will be playing the role of Lee Kang Moo, a leader of team 1 NSP (National Security Planning). He is a man of principle and is dedicated to his work.

"Snowdrop" is written by Yoo Hyun Min and will be directed by Jo Hyun Tak. It is scheduled to air in 2021.
